Telegraph: Two Greek hotels with best kids’clubs in the world

Two Greek hotels, Domes of Elounda in Crete and Sani Beach Hotel in Halkidiki are among hotels with the best kids’ clubs globally, according toTelegraph.
The British newspaper describes them as follows:
Domes of Elounda, Crete, Greece
The Ark kids’ club hosts a football school, golf academy, and dance school led by a Strictly Come Dancing Greece judge. There is even a pop-up Six Senses children’s spa. Several play areas, two pools and other activities including circus acting and mini Olympic games, also help to establish this place as one of the best options for children in Crete.
Sani Beach Hotel, Halkidiki, Greece
Activities on offer include swimming lessons and nature excursions. There are also pool games, picnics and parties. The offerings for older children include DJ classes, a dance academy doing everything from ballet to breakdancing, and a football academy.
